SUMMARY
A versatile detached house with panoramic sea views over Paignton, Preston & across to Brixham & Berry Head. Comprising entrance hallway, lounge, dining room, kitchen, 4 dbl beds, en-suite shower room & 2 bathrooms. Benefiting from UPVc DG, GCH, gardens, garage & parking for 2 vehicles. No Chain.


DESCRIPTION
A versatile detached house with panoramic sea views over Paignton, Preston and across to Brixham and Berry Head. The accommodation comprises entrance hallway, lounge, dining room, kitchen, four double bedrooms, en-suite shower room and two bathrooms. Benefiting from gas central heating, UPVc double glazing, front, side and rear gardens and a garage with driveway parking for two vehicles. No Chain.
